With double glazing, a professional will install an insulated glass unit (IGU) into the window frame. An IGU consists of two panes of glass and a layer of still air or inert gas in between.
So, the total double glazing thickness in millimetres (mm) encompasses the thickness of each pane of glass and the thickness of the gap in between.
Both the added thermal resistance you get from two panes of glass instead of one and the insulation effect of the airspace – which slows down the movement of thermal energy thus reducing heat loss – are what create the benefits of double glazing and lower your heating and cooling costs.
And, the thicker each of these elements are, the better performance you’ll get out of your windows.
